方法一:使用IF函数 该问题提到了两个指定条件(“上”和“下”),可以使用嵌套的IF函数来实现。在 B1 单元格中显示相应的值,输入以下公式:=IF(ISNUMBER(SEARCH("上", A1)), "A", IF(ISNUMBER(SEARCH("下", A1)), "B", ""))这个公式的工作原理如下:SEARCH("上", A1)查找单元格 A1
注意:若要取消正在执行的搜索,请按 Esc。 检查单元格中是否有任何文本 若要执行此任务,请使用ISTEXT函数。 检查单元格是否与特定文本匹配 使用IF函数返回指定条件的结果。 检查单元格的一部分是否与特定文本匹配 若要执行此任务,请使用IF、SEARCH和ISNUMBER函数。 注意:SEARCH函数不区分大小写。
1. SEARCH 函数适用于不区分大小写的文本,如果您想检查区分大小写的文本,应将 SEARCH 函数替换为 FIND 函数。如下所示:=IF(ISNUMBER(FIND("comp",C2)), "否", "是") 2. 在 IF 公式中作为参数的文本值,必须用“双引号”括起来。示例3:对日期值使用 IF 函数 ...
=IF(ISNUMBER(FIND("abc", A1)), "文字中包含abc", "文字中不包含abc") 2. SEARCH函数:SEARCH函数与FIND函数类似,不同之处在于SEARCH函数不区分大小写。 语法:SEARCH(要查找的字符串, 在哪个字符串中查找, [开始位置]) 示例:假设A1单元格中有一个字符串,我们需要查找其中包含字符"abc"的位置。 =IF(ISNU...
=IFERROR(SEARCH(B5,B2),”NotFound”) 示例2: 在SEARCH中使用通配符 检查SEARCH函数结果的另一种方式是结合使用ISNUMBER函数。如果找到字符串,那么SEARCH函数的结果是一个数字,因此ISNUMBER函数的结果为TRUE。如果没有找到文本,那么SEARCH函数的结果是错误值,ISNUMBER函数返回FALSE...
比如判断字符串中是否包含大写字母A,可用公式=IF(ISNUMBER(FIND("A",A2)),"有","无")。含有小写字母a的结果是无,该公式里的FIND函数提取的是指定的字符区分大小写,如下图所示 2.判断字符串是否含有某英文字符,区分大小写,可用SEARCH函数代替FIND函数 ...
这个公式首先使用SEARCH函数在A1单元格中查找“apple”,如果找到,SEARCH函数将返回其起始位置,然后ISNUMBER函数将判断这个位置是否是数字(即是否找到了“apple”),如果是数字,IF函数将返回“含有”,否则返回“不含有”。另外,如果你想忽略大小写,可以使用SEARCH函数的变体——SEARCHB函数,它与SEARCH...
例如,使用IF和SEARCH函数来创建一个包含函数:=IF(ISNUMBER(SEARCH("超", A1)), "包含", "不包含")公式可对A列中的文本进行判断,若是包含条件中指定的文本,则会返回“包含”,否则,返回“不包含”,然后,再通过筛选功能将“包含”的数据筛选出来即可。掌握了以上分享的这些方法,我们可以更加灵活地在Exce...
选择输出单元格,并使用以下公式:=IF(AND(ISNUMBER(SEARCH("string1",cell)), ISNUMBER(SEARCH("string2",cell))), value_to_return,"") 。 对于我们的示例,我们要检查的单元格是A2。我们正在寻找“连帽衫”和“黑色”,返回值将为Valid。在这种情况下,您可以将公式更改为=IF(AND(ISNUMBER(SEARCH("hoodie",...
=IF(SUMPRODUCT(--(ISNUMBER(SEARCH(C2, $A$2:$A$12))), "Yes", "No") Copy=IF(COUNTIF($A$2:$A$12,"*"&C2&"*")>0, "Yes", "No") Copy 注意:在公式中,C2 表示您要检查其值是否存在于另一列中的单元格。范围 $A$2:$A$12 是您要与其进行比较的列,以查看它是否包含来自 C2 的值...